Festival & Concert

 

 

A week-long event, the World Peace Festival will have dozens of pavilions, representing humanitarian, world peace, and environmental organizations from every continent, will provide multimedia venues for displays, seminars and documentaries to inform, educate and entertain tens of thousands of attendees from around the world. There will be a wide array of seminars, displays and documentaries, all involving environmental sustainability, universal peace, human rights and Earth ethics.

On the day the Nobel Prizes are awarded, the world's greatest artists will perform for peace during a 24-hour concert, televised live throughout world. The World Peace Concert is artistic activism at its best: We inform, encourage, and stimulate artists' awareness of social and ecological issues, then create an information avenue to communicate their messages to the world.

Ambassador Andrew Young's GoodWorks International will organize the African Pavilion where Africa-based peace, humanitarian, environmental and species preservation organizations will be housed.
